Survival data for premature infants born before 32 weeks gestational age is crucial for family counseling and resource planning. Mortality rates varied significantly by gestational age, with no survival below 26 weeks.

Background:

  • Accurate prognosis data for neonates is essential for parental counseling and healthcare resource allocation.
  • Local data is particularly important due to variations in care and outcomes across different settings.
  • Premature infants, especially those born before 32 weeks gestational age, represent a vulnerable population requiring specific prognostic information.

Purpose of the Study:

  • To present local data on the survival rates of infants born before 32 weeks gestational age.
  • To provide data for counseling families of premature infants.
  • To inform departmental resource allocation strategies based on observed neonatal outcomes.

Main Methods:

  • Retrospective analysis of survival to discharge data for infants born below 32 weeks gestational age.
  • Data collected over a one-year period from a single clinical unit.
  • Calculation of mortality rates per thousand live births for specific gestational age ranges (26-31 weeks).

Main Results:

  • No infants born below 26 weeks gestational age survived to discharge.
  • Mortality rates per thousand live births were: 875 at 26 weeks, 500 at 27 weeks, 500 at 28 weeks, 615 at 29 weeks, 158 at 30 weeks, and 105 at 31 weeks.
  • Significant variation in survival rates observed across different gestational ages within the <32 weeks group.

Conclusions:

  • Local survival data for extremely premature infants is vital for accurate prognostication and resource management.
  • The study highlights the critical impact of gestational age on neonatal survival outcomes.
  • Challenges in data interpretation within a specific clinical setting necessitate careful consideration of local factors.
